The best time to go to Chatton is during the late spring, summer, and early autumn months, specifically from May to September, when the weather is generally at its finest.
During these months, you'll experience longer daylight hours and milder temperatures, making it ideal for exploring the Northumberland countryside and enjoying outdoor activities. This period allows for comfortable walks along the River Till, visits to the nearby Cheviot Hills, and exploring the many historic sites without the chill or dampness that can come with other seasons.
